LaCava, Phillips punch regional tickets at Arkansas Twilight

Daniel LaCava and Duncan Phillips clocked their first regional-qualifying times of the season in their respective events at the Arkansas Twilight on Friday at John McDonnell Field.
LaCava finished sixth in a packed 1, 500-meter race that included numerous former All-Americans from around the nation and many of his current and former teammates. His time of 3: 45. 33, a personal best, qualifies him for the Mideast Regional Championships next month and ranks 10 th in the SEC.
Phillips also clocked a personal-best but his was in the 800 meters. Another packed event, Phillips also ran with numerous All-Americans and current and former Razorbacks. His time of 1: 49. 65 was good for a sixth-place finish and ranks ninth in the SEC, first among freshmen. He also holds the second-best 800-meter time run by a freshman in the nation this season.
J-Mee Samuels had a decent outing in the 100-meter dash. His time of 10. 28 was good enough for the event win but doesn’t improve his season best of 10. 12, clocked two weeks ago at the John McDonnell Invitational. He still ranks No. 3 in the nation in the 100 meters and No. 4 in the nation in the 200 meters (20. 55 ).
